JAYDEN LONDERVILLE SET TO MAKE ATVMX PRO DEBUT AT DAYTONA
4130 Motorsports Rider to Compete in Pro and Pro-Am Classes This Season
WAUSAU, Wis. – 4130 Motorsports’ Jayden Londerville, the 2024 ATVMX Pro Sport Champion and Pro-Am Runner-Up, is set to make his pro debut in the AMA Pro ATV Motocross National Championship (ATVMX) during Daytona Bike Week. The 20-year-old from Wausau, Wisconsin, will contest aboard his Yamaha YFZ450R in the pro and pro-am classes throughout the 10-round series.

“This year at Daytona will be my pro debut,” Londerville said. “I’ve been looking forward to this moment for my whole racing career and never really realized how fast it would come up. This has been my best off-season so far. I have been staying down in South Florida training with a few other pros for the past two months and definitely feel like I am making huge strides on and off the bike with fitness and speed. I’m excited to see what this year has in store for me and my team. I’m very excited to see how all of our hard work pays off.”

Returning for his third year in the pro-am class, Londerville will focus on attempting to secure the championship while also collecting valuable data — in terms of bike setup and varying track conditions — to help advance his riding skills.
“I’m doing it for more seat time, to get better as a rider overall, and to really focus on being more consistent on the track,” Londerville said.
Team Manager Leon Spinden III, who has been with the 4130 Motorsports team since 2020, will also serve as Londerville’s mechanic throughout the year.

“As the anticipation builds for not only the season opener of 2025 but Jayden’s pro debut, I am eager to get this season started,” said Spinden III. “The bike program has been meticulously overhauled, and we have some great partners behind us. All of that, combined with Jayden’s off-season progress and dedication, should amount to an unforgettable rookie season as an ATVMX pro.”

Operated by the ATV Promoters Group, the series kicks off on March 4 at Daytona International Speedway. Fans can attend the races or watch select events via livestream to support Londerville in his battle against the world’s top ATV athletes:
- March 4 | Daytona International Speedway: Daytona, FL (pro class only)
- March 8 | Decker Training Facility: Fountain, FL (pro class only)
- March 29-30 | Echeconnee MX: Lizella, GA
- April 26-27 | Lake Sugar Tree Motorsports Park: Axton, VA
- May 10-11 | Ironman Raceway: Crawfordsville, IN
- May 24-25 | Sunset Ridge MX: Walnut, IL
- June 21-22 | Budds Creek Raceway: Mechanicsville, MD
- July 5-6 | Tomahawk MX Park: Hedgesville, WV
- July 19-20 | Pleasure Valley Raceway: Seward, PA
- August 9-10 | Briarcliff MX: Nashport, OH
